概括
此摘要是机器生成的。

来自可穿戴设备的个性化健康反可以促进神经退行性疾病 (NDD) 患者的行为改变. 分享报告,并将其视为有用,是影响这些变化的关键因素.

背景情况:

  • 可穿戴技术有可能影响老年人和患有神经退行性疾病 (NDD) 的人的健康行为.
  • 关于可穿戴健康反如何特别影响这些人群的行为变化,目前的研究有限.
  • 在HANDDS-ONT研究中,使用与利益相关者和患有NDD的个人共同设计的个性化反报告调查了行为变化.

研究的目的:

  • 在提供个性化健康反报告后,检查老年人和NDD患者的行为变化.
  • 为了确定行为变化的预测因素,以响应可穿戴技术的反.
  • 了解个性化健康反对自我管理的有用性和影响.

主要方法:

  • 参与者 (n=203;98对照组,105NDD) 佩戴可穿戴设备7-10天,收集身体活动,久坐和睡眠数据.
  • 个性化反报告在指导会议中生成和审查.
  • 预期观察性研究设计,包括干预后的调查和采访,以评估反效用和行为变化,并补充统计和专题分析.

主要成果:

  • 在NDD和对照组之间的行为变化比例或数量方面,没有发现显著的群体差异.
  • 与家人/朋友分享反报告 (OR=2.258) 和认为报告有帮助 (OR=-0.527) 是行为变化的重要预测因素.
  • 主题分析揭示了考虑改变,寻求健康信息和影响行为修改的社会支持的主题.

结论:

  • 个性化健康反报告可以激励NDD个体的行为改变.
  • 感知到的反和社交分享的帮助是行为改变的关键决定因素.
  • 可穿戴技术和量身定制的反显示出增强NDD群体自我管理和健康优化的承诺.
